BACKCOUNTRY GUIDE – SHORT SEASON (December – February)

NBS is seeking backcountry guides for the peak dates of 2024/25 season (early December – mid February). Do you loving skiing or riding and are committed to guest experience and customer service? This is the position for you!

NBS has grown to be one of the largest international snowsports schools in the Niseko area. NBS prides itself on its outstanding reputation of high quality instruction and high level customer service. We believe the key to this success is supporting our staff in every way possible.

Key Responsibilities

·         Meeting/Greeting guests on the meeting area

·         Guiding guests around the Niseko Resort ski area and the nearby Rusutsu Resort

Remuneration Package

·         Hourly rate varies depending on qualifications and experience

·         Personal All Mountain Lift Pass (Grand Hirafu, Hanazono, Niseko Village & Annupuri Resorts)

·         SIM card for work and personal use (or reimbursement of 3000 JPY if you provide your own)

·         A high quality, warm and durable instructing uniform is provided for work

·         Staff Locker Room 1 minute walk to the slopes

·         Subsidised staff accommodation in Hirafu village and Kutchan

Employment Dates and Working Hours

Short Season contract dates: 2nd December, 2024 – 16th February, 2025

As with any seasonal work, hours and dates of work are snow and customer dependent.
